Planning your next holiday is an interesting process that can result in an unforgettable and enriching experience. Whether you're dreaming of a relaxing beach vacation, a daring trek in the mountains, or a cultural city break, mindful preparation is essential to making your trip a success. Here are some tips and concepts to assist you prepare the ideal holiday.

The first step in preparing your vacation is deciding when to go. Consider the time of year, the weather condition at your selected destination, and your personal schedule. If you're versatile with your dates, you may be able to take advantage of off-peak travel times, which can use lower costs and fewer crowds. Research study the very best time to visit your destination based upon your interests-- whether it's the dry season for a beach vacation or the festive season for a cultural experience. As soon as you have actually chosen your travel dates, start trying to find flights and accommodation early to protect the very best deals.

Picking the best accommodation is vital for a comfortable and enjoyable vacation. Think about the kind of experience you want-- whether it's a high-end hotel, a cosy bed and breakfast, or a self-catering apartment or condo. Consider the area of your accommodation in relation to the attractions and activities you prepare to visit. Remaining in the heart of a city may provide convenience, while a countryside retreat might supply peace and tranquillity. Research study your choices thoroughly, read evaluations, and book your accommodation as early as possible to get the very best rates and availability. Having a comfy place to stay can considerably improve your vacation experience.

Another important element of vacation planning is developing a well-balanced schedule. Start by researching the top destinations and activities at your destination, and make a list of the important things you absolutely want to see and do. Arrange these activities into a day-to-day schedule, enabling a lot of time to unwind and explore at your own speed. Make certain to include a mix of experiences, from sightseeing and dining to leisure and adventure. It's likewise crucial to be flexible and leave some room for spontaneous discoveries or modifications in strategies. A well-thought-out itinerary can help you take advantage of your time away and make sure that you don't miss out on any must-see sights or experiences.

Budgeting is another essential element of vacation preparation. Start by setting a realistic budget that covers all aspects of your journey, consisting of travel, lodging, meals, activities, and any other expenses you might incur. Research the costs connected with your location and change your spending plan accordingly. Look for ways to save money, such as reserving flights and lodging beforehand, taking advantage of special offers, or choosing budget-friendly activities. It's also a good idea to set aside some extra money for unforeseen costs or special treats during your holiday. By planning your budget carefully, you can enjoy a hassle-free holiday without worrying about overspending.

Finally, consider the usefulness of your journey. Make certain your copyright stands and updated, and inspect if you need any visas or vaccinations for your destination. It's likewise crucial to acquire travel insurance coverage to cover any unforeseen events, such as flight cancellations, medical emergencies, or lost luggage. Load sensibly, taking into consideration the climate and activities you'll be doing, and make a checklist to guarantee you do not forget anything essential. If you're travelling abroad, it's also an excellent concept to research the local custom-mades and culture so you can be considerate and avoid any misconceptions. By looking after these details in advance, you can enjoy your vacation with assurance and make the most of your time away.
